The Escalating War on AI Voice Fraud: Regulatory Shifts and Technological Defenses

Sat, Aug 01 2026 /Mpelembe Media/ — The telecommunications landscape is currently battling a severe escalation in call-based fraud, fueled by the convergence of cheap Voice over Internet Protocol (VoIP) routing and highly accessible generative artificial intelligence (AI). Scammers are increasingly utilizing AI voice cloning—which requires just seconds of audio—alongside caller ID spoofing to execute highly convincing voice phishing (vishing) attacks. These sophisticated scams target everyday consumers through family emergency and political impersonation ploys, as well as businesses via CEO fraud and targeted IT help desk breaches aimed at stealing credentials and initiating unauthorized wire transfers. Recognizing that traditional endpoint security often falls short against these social engineering tactics, cybersecurity experts are urging organizations to implement zero-trust frameworks and voice-independent verification methods, such as out-of-band multi-factor authentication, while advising consumers to adopt low-tech defenses like secret family codewords.

In response to the multi-billion-dollar losses caused by these scams, a bipartisan coalition of 49 state attorneys general has heavily pressured the Federal Communications Commission (FCC) to strengthen its regulations and cut off scammers’ access to legitimate phone numbers. Consequently, the FCC has aggressively expanded its regulatory and enforcement infrastructure. In early 2024, the FCC issued a Declaratory Ruling classifying AI-generated cloned voices as “artificial” under the Telephone Consumer Protection Act (TCPA), making their use in robocalls illegal without prior express consent and opening the door to statutory damages. The Commission has also implemented sweeping mandates requiring all voice service providers to utilize Do Not Originate (DNO) registries—which block calls from invalid or inbound-only numbers—and has strengthened its Robocall Mitigation Database (RMD) with stricter filing requirements and hefty fines for inaccurate submissions. Furthermore, the FCC is pushing for rigorous “Know Your Customer” (KYC) protocols, demanding that originating providers comprehensively vet their clients before granting network access. This heightened enforcement environment was recently underscored by a landmark $1 million consent decree against Lingo Telecom, which faced penalties for failing to authenticate caller IDs and properly vet upstream traffic after transmitting thousands of AI deepfake robocalls impersonating President Biden during the New Hampshire primary.

1. Your Voice Can Be Cloned in Under 30 Seconds

The biological uniqueness of a human voice was once considered a robust security identifier. That era is over. Modern machine learning has turned our most personal biological trait into a low-cost, scalable tool for fraud.Using as little as 30 seconds of audio harvested from a podcast, webinar, or social media interview, attackers can create a “passable” clone. These systems use encoder-decoder architectures and diffusion-based models to process audio into spectrograms, mapping frequency and amplitude over time. The AI doesn’t just mimic your pitch; it learns your cadence, your tone, and even the “filler words” (the  ums  and  ahs ) that make your voice sound authentically human.”A person’s voice used to be considered a strong signal for trust. Now however, an attacker can create a realistic voice clone with just 30 seconds of audio, meaning relying on voice alone as authentication is no longer an option.” —  ThreatLocker

2. The “A-Level” Secret: Why Your Business Calls Are Still Marked “Spam Likely”

Many businesses believe that being “compliant” with STIR/SHAKEN—the framework mandated by the FCC to authenticate caller ID—is enough to ensure their calls connect. But compliance is a binary threshold; what actually drives your revenue is the “attestation level” your provider assigns to your traffic. If your provider is signing at a lower level, terminating carriers (like Verizon or AT&T) will treat your calls with reduced trust, often flagging them before they ever reach the client.To secure the coveted “A-Level” status, the rules are specific: the signing provider must have a direct authenticated relationship with the customer and must have  itself assigned the telephone number  to that caller.

  • Full Attestation (A):  The provider has authenticated the caller and established a verified association with the number because they provided that identity themselves. This is the gold standard for connectivity.
  • Partial Attestation (B):  The provider has authenticated the caller but cannot confirm they have the right to use the specific number displayed. These calls are frequently penalized.
  • Gateway Attestation (C):  The provider received the call from another network and cannot vouch for the caller or the number. These are the most likely to be blocked entirely.
3. The Pixel-Exclusivity Trap: Why Consumer Features Fail Professionals

Tools like Google Pixel’s “Call Screen” offer excellent personal privacy but are a strategic bottleneck for professional operations. For small businesses, relying on these “on-device” features can lead to massive missed opportunities.Google’s “Maximum Protection” setting forces every unknown caller to talk to a robot. For a  physiotherapy practice , this means a potential patient hears a generic Google Assistant prompt rather than a professional greeting like, “Welcome to Practice Name, how can we help you?” Similarly, a  property manager  needs to triage urgent maintenance calls, while a  tax advisor  needs to capture specific client data—tasks a one-question consumer robot cannot perform. Furthermore, these transcripts stay siloed on the device, failing to sync with your CRM or team tools. In a professional context, a feature designed for personal privacy becomes a customer service liability.

4. The 2026 Regulatory Wave: RMD Recertification and the Lingo Lesson

The FCC is tightening the screws on the Robocall Mitigation Database (RMD), moving from “voluntary” to mandatory strictness. Starting in 2026, the  filing window opens February 1 , with a mandatory annual recertification deadline of  March 1, 2026 .The urgency stems from high-profile failures like the  Lingo Telecom  case. In early 2024, political consultant  Steve Kramer  and  Life Corp  were allegedly involved in originating deepfake calls of President Biden during the New Hampshire primary. Lingo Telecom improperly applied A-level attestations to these calls by relying on a generic, “check-the-box” contract that shifted the responsibility of verification onto the customer.”A provider may not satisfy the obligation for a verified association between the customer and the calling number with a generic, blanket, check-the-box agreement that shifts the entire responsibility for compliance onto the customer.” —  FCC Consent Decree via TransNexusFailure to accurately recertify carries a  $10,000 base forfeiture  for false information. For the strategist, this means your provider’s “compliance” must be active and verified, not just a legal abstraction.

5. DNO (Do Not Originate): The New Shield for Your Inbound Lines

Scammers have long weaponized “inbound-only” numbers—like your customer support desk or appointment line—for outbound spoofing. When they blast fraudulent calls using your support number, it is  your  brand reputation that gets trashed in carrier analytics.A major regulatory win arrives on  December 15, 2025 , with the mandate for “Do Not Originate” (DNO) enforcement. This requires providers to block any outbound call that claims to come from a number on a DNO list (numbers that should never make outbound calls). If your provider isn’t proactively enforcing DNO, your inbound lines remain open for reputation-destroying exploitation by third-party fraudsters.

6. The Psychology of a Vishing Attack: Why Being “Helpful” is a Security Risk

Modern vishing succeeds by exploiting human neuroscience and organizational “authority bias.” Attackers use  soundboards  to create realistic background environments—like the ambient noise of an airport terminal—to imply a high-level executive is calling in a rush before a flight.According to ThreatLocker,  Level 1 support staff  are the primary targets because they have the highest pressure to be “helpful” and the least security training. Attackers will often  “rotate through people,”  calling repeatedly until they find a susceptible employee who can be manipulated or even bribed. In a “culture of compliance,” an employee may feel that questioning an urgent request from a (cloned) CEO is a form of insubordination. This combination of AI realism and psychological pressure overrides the skepticism we typically apply to digital links.
